A CT brain is ordered to look at the structures of the brain and evaluate for the presence of pathology such as masstumor fluid collection such as an abcess ischemic processes such as a stroke.

A CT scan can help find bleeding and enlargement of the fluid-filled spaces in the brain called ventricles.

Computed tomography CT and magnetic resonance imaging MRI have revolutionized the study of the brain by allowing doctors and researchers to look at the brain noninvasively.
